World Famous Artists are Guests of the Sarajevo Philharmonic

Published: April 11, 2014
Share
SHARE

Alexander_BuzlovThe Sarajevo Philharmonic will continue its regular concert activities with a concert on Saturday at the National Theatre Sarajevo.

The Philharmonic announced that this concert will include guest visits by world famous artists, which our audience already had the opportunity to hear.

Russian cellist Alexander Buzlov will perform the Concert for cello and Orchestra of the German composer Robert Schumann.

The composer will be Gianluco Marciano from Italy. There will be two other performances, the Manfred Overture and the Symphony nr. 4 in D minor.

Classical music is not just a small privilege of a small circle of people. The Sarajevo Philharmonic is proving this and thus began making classical music available to all citizens of Sarajevo. In the next few weeks, all members of the Sarajevo Philharmonic will visit schools in order to educate children and youth on various musical forms, and are preparing a concert for the youngest members of the audience on 17 April called „Simfonija igračaka“.

The concert will be held in the National Theatre Sarajevo at 12:00 and at 14:00.

(Source: Fena)
